How much do Electric Motor, Power Tool, and Related Repairers make in Colorado?
The median Electric Motor, Power Tool, and Related Repairers in Colorado earns $61,570 per year (BLS May 2025), about $29.60 per hour.
What is that after taxes?
$61,570 gross in Colorado keeps $49,651 after federal income tax ($5,208), FICA ($4,710) and state income tax ($2,001) — $4,138 per month, a 80.6% keep-rate.
How does Colorado compare to the national median for Electric Motor, Power Tool, and Related Repairers?
The Colorado median is $5,360 above the national median of $56,210.
Which state pays Electric Motor, Power Tool, and Related Repairers the most?
Illinois has the highest median gross for Electric Motor, Power Tool, and Related Repairers at $79,320 — but compare take-home, not gross: state taxes change the order.
